😊 R语言diag函数的用法
发布时间:2025-03-25 21:59:20来源:网易
在数据分析和统计中,R语言是一个非常强大的工具。今天,我们来聊聊`diag()`函数,它在处理矩阵时特别有用!✨
首先,`diag()`的基本功能是提取或创建对角矩阵。如果你有一个矩阵,可以通过`diag(matrix)`提取主对角线上的元素。比如,对于一个3x3的单位矩阵,`diag(matrix)`会返回 `[1, 1, 1]`。🌟
其次,`diag(v)`还可以用来创建一个以向量`v`为主对角线的方阵。例如,`diag(c(1, 2, 3))`会生成一个3x3的对角矩阵:
```
[,1] [,2] [,3]
[1,]100
[2,]020
[3,]003
```
此外,`diag(k)`可以直接生成一个k阶的单位矩阵,方便快捷。🙌
掌握`diag()`函数,可以让你更高效地操作矩阵数据,在数据分析中节省大量时间!💡
希望这篇小科普对你有帮助!如果喜欢,记得点赞收藏哦~💖
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。